Why This Recipe Works
- Butter Base : High-fat butter ensures a dense, cake-like crumb.
- Lemon Zest : Adds intense citrus aroma without extra liquid.
- Baking Powder : Lifts the dough slightly for a tender texture.
Variations to Try
- Poppy Seed Delight : Fold 1 tbsp poppy seeds into the batter.
- Lemon-Lavender : Add 1 tsp dried culinary lavender to the dough.
- Citrus Swap : Use orange or lime zest for a different twist.
- Gluten-Free : Substitute 1:1 gluten-free flour.
- Vegan Option : Use plant-based butter and egg replacer (like flax eggs).
Tips for Success
- Room-Temp Ingredients : Ensures smooth mixing and even texture.
- Don’t Overmix : Stir until just combined to avoid toughness.
- Chill Dough : If cookies spread too much, refrigerate dough for 15 minutes before baking.
- Storage : Keep in an airtight container for up to 5 days or freeze dough balls.
